                        • #13
                          esp work by measuring tyres rotation, if you got 1 different wheel size in there, esp & abs will not functioning properly hence code.

                          Comment


                          • #14
                            Thats right guys, abs and esp all calculated by rolling radius, tyre pressures included, which allowed them to get rid of the RF transmittors in the valves
